PCI контроллер — описание, принципы работы и его роль в компьютерных системах

PCI контроллер – это плата, которая служит для подключения и управления периферийными устройствами компьютера, используя интерфейс PCI (Peripheral Component Interconnect). Он является неотъемлемой частью современных системных плат и позволяет подключать различные устройства, такие как видеокарты, звуковые карты, сетевые адаптеры и другие, к компьютеру.

PCI контроллер выполняет ряд важных функций. Он отвечает за передачу данных между центральным процессором компьютера и периферийными устройствами, обеспечивая синхронизацию работы всех компонентов. Кроме того, он контролирует электрические и тайминговые параметры передачи данных, чтобы обеспечить их надежность и стабильность. Это позволяет создавать высокопроизводительные системы с минимальными задержками и сбоями.

Принцип работы PCI контроллера базируется на технологии шин, где данные передаются по специальным проводникам. Контроллер принимает команды от центрального процессора и передает их устройствам, а также получает данные от периферийных устройств и передает их обратно центральному процессору. Все это происходит с использованием специальных протоколов и преобразователей сигналов, которые обеспечивают совместимость и эффективную работу системы.

Что такое PCI контроллер

PCI контроллер выполняет ряд функций, включая маршрутизацию данных между устройствами, проверку целостности передаваемой информации, синхронизацию операций и обеспечение безопасности данных.

Тема опроса: отношение к искусственному интеллекту
Я полностью поддерживаю использование искусственного интеллекта во всех сферах жизни.
16.67%
Я считаю, что искусственный интеллект может быть опасным и должен использоваться только под строгим контролем.
66.67%
Я нейтрален/нейтральна к искусственному интеллекту, так как не имею личного опыта взаимодействия с ним.
16.67%
Я не знаю, что такое искусственный интеллект.
0%
Проголосовало: 6

Он имеет важное значение для работы компьютера, поскольку обеспечивает эффективную коммуникацию между различными устройствами, такими как видеокарты, звуковые карты, сетевые адаптеры и другие компоненты системы.

PCI контроллеры широко применяются в современных компьютерных системах и являются стандартным интерфейсом для подключения периферийных устройств. Они позволяют расширять функциональность компьютера и повышать его производительность.

Использование PCI контроллера позволяет сократить количество кабелей и устройств в системе, улучшить скорость передачи данных и обеспечить более надежную работу компьютера в целом.

Важными принципами работы PCI контроллера являются оперативность передачи данных, надежность хранения и обработки информации, а также совместимость с различными устройствами и операционными системами.

Контроллер осуществляет коммуникацию с устройствами по шине PCI с помощью так называемых уникальных адресов, которые идентифицируют каждое подключенное устройство. Это позволяет обеспечить правильную маршрутизацию данных и предотвратить ошибки при передаче информации.

Читайте также:  Что такое наука в пятом классе, и какие основные понятия и примеры следует знать

Кроме того, PCI контроллеры поддерживают различные протоколы для передачи данных, включая PCI Express, PCI-X и PCI. Это позволяет подключать различные устройства с разной скоростью передачи данных к одной шине PCI.

Что такое PCI контроллер

Главная функция PCI контроллера заключается в маршрутизации данных между устройствами, подключенными к шине PCI. Он определяет, какие данные должны быть переданы, куда и в какое время. Кроме того, контроллер обеспечивает согласованность и синхронизацию передачи данных между устройствами.

PCI контроллер также выполняет другие важные функции, такие как управление прерываниями, управление энергопотреблением, контроль доступа к памяти и др. Он обеспечивает эффективную работу всех устройств, подключенных к шине PCI, и позволяет им взаимодействовать друг с другом.

Одним из основных преимуществ PCI контроллера является его высокая скорость передачи данных. Благодаря высокой пропускной способности шины PCI и эффективной работе контроллера, можно достичь высокой производительности компьютера и обеспечить быструю передачу данных между устройствами.

В целом, PCI контроллер является важной частью компьютерной системы и играет ключевую роль в обеспечении правильного функционирования устройств, подключенных к шине PCI. Он обеспечивает эффективную передачу данных между устройствами, контролирует их работу и обеспечивает взаимодействие между ними.

Определение и функции

Одной из основных функций PCI контроллера является установление и поддержание связи между центральным процессором компьютера и периферийными устройствами, такими как видеокарты, звуковые карты, сетевые адаптеры и т.д. Контроллер обеспечивает передачу данных между этими устройствами и центральным процессором.

PCI контроллер также отвечает за обнаружение и идентификацию подключенных устройств, управление их работой, а также контроль доступа к шине PCI. Контроллер осуществляет арбитраж – процесс распределения приоритетов при доступе к шине PCI, чтобы обеспечить эффективное взаимодействие между устройствами и максимальную пропускную способность.

Более новые версии PCI контроллеров поддерживают различные расширения и дополнительные функции, такие как Plug and Play (PnP), Hot Plug и поддержка высоких скоростей передачи данных.

В целом, PCI контроллер является важным компонентом компьютерной системы, позволяющим эффективно управлять и контролировать работу периферийных устройств, обеспечивая их взаимодействие с центральным процессором и другими компонентами системы.

История развития PCI контроллеров

Исходный PCI (Peripheral Component Interconnect) стандарт был разработан в 1991 году и представлял собой интерфейсную систему, предназначенную для подключения различных периферийных устройств к материнской плате компьютера. В отличие от ранее использовавшихся стандартов, таких как ISA и VLB, PCI обладал рядом преимуществ, таких как более высокая скорость передачи данных, поддержка плаг-энд-плей (подключение и отключение устройств во время работы компьютера) и возможность работы с несколькими устройствами одновременно.

Читайте также:  Мышечно-суставные дисбалансы в Москве - все, что вам нужно знать о МСД и профессионалах, помогающих решить эту проблему

Однако, с течением времени, развивались не только компьютеры, но и потребности пользователей. В 1993 году был представлен PCI 2.0, который внес ряд улучшений, включая увеличение скорости передачи данных и добавление новых возможностей для графических карт.

В 1995 году был представлен следующий этап развития – PCI 2.1. Этот стандарт включал в себя поддержку новых типов устройств и улучшенные спецификации для устройств хранения данных.

Дальнейшее развитие PCI привело к представлению PCI 2.2 в 1998 году. Он включал в себя поддержку устройств с высокой пропускной способностью, таких как Gigabit Ethernet и USB 2.0.

Следующий шаг в развитии стандарта был сделан в 2002 году с выпуском PCI-X (PCI Extended). Он представлял собой улучшенную версию PCI, обладающую гораздо большей пропускной способностью и поддержкой серверных приложений.

В настоящее время, последней стадией развития является PCI Express (PCIe). Этот стандарт предлагает еще большую пропускную способность и возможности для передачи данных, и использование его в современных компьютерах является стандартной практикой.

Таким образом, история развития PCI контроллеров свидетельствует о постоянном стремлении к увеличению производительности и функциональности компьютерных систем.

Принципы работы PCI контроллера

Основной принцип работы PCI контроллера заключается в передаче данных между периферийными устройствами и центральным процессором. Для этого контроллер использует разъем PCI, который является стандартным интерфейсом для подключения периферийных устройств.

Передача данных в PCI контроллере осуществляется с помощью специальных команд. Каждое периферийное устройство имеет свой уникальный адрес, по которому контроллер определяет, куда именно отправить данные. Периферийные устройства также могут отправлять запросы на чтение или запись данных.

PCI контроллер осуществляет маршрутизацию данных между периферийными устройствами и центральным процессором. Он контролирует передачу данных по шине и обеспечивает их правильное направление.

В процессе работы PCI контроллер также занимается управлением ресурсами, такими как адресное пространство и прерывания. Он устанавливает соединение между периферийными устройствами и операционной системой, позволяя им взаимодействовать друг с другом.

Таким образом, принципы работы PCI контроллера включают передачу данных между периферийными устройствами и центральным процессором, маршрутизацию данных и управление ресурсами. Это позволяет обеспечить эффективную работу компьютерной системы и обеспечить взаимодействие между различными устройствами.

Разъем PCI и передача данных

Внешне разъем PCI представляет собой слот с несколькими контактными площадками, которые соединяются с контактными пинами на плате устройства. Данная конструкция позволяет быстро и легко подключать и отключать устройства от материнской платы.

Читайте также:  Четные числа — определение, свойства и примеры

Передача данных в разъеме PCI осуществляется по шине, которая состоит из нескольких параллельных проводников. Каждый проводник представляет собой отдельный сигнальный линк, по которому передается информация. Важно отметить, что каждое устройство имеет свою отдельную пару проводников для передачи данных.

Для обеспечения надежной передачи данных в разъеме PCI используется специальный протокол обмена информацией. Устройства передают данные в формате пакетов, каждый из которых содержит адрес назначения, адрес отправителя, контрольные суммы и сами данные. Пакет проходит через все устройства на шине и только адресат извлекает необходимую информацию.

Одна из особенностей разъема PCI заключается в его возможности работы в режимах 32-битной и 64-битной передачи данных. В зависимости от спецификации, разъем может поддерживать определенную ширину данных, что позволяет увеличить скорость передачи информации.

В целом, разъем PCI обеспечивает надежную и эффективную передачу данных между устройствами компьютера. Он позволяет подключать и отключать устройства в процессе работы компьютера, обеспечивает высокую скорость передачи и обеспечивает надежность передачи данных.

Как работает маршрутизация данных в PCI контроллере

Маршрутизация данных в PCI контроллере осуществляется специальным алгоритмом, который определяет, какой устройству будет передано поступившее сообщение или команда.

Когда основная система отправляет данные в PCI контроллер, он сначала их буферизует и анализирует заголовок сообщения, который содержит информацию о конечном устройстве-получателе. Затем PCI контроллер производит поиск в своей таблице устройств для определения пути передачи данных до нужного устройства.

В таблице устройств хранится информация о каждом подключенном устройстве, его идентификатор и адрес. При поступлении данных контроллер сравнивает адрес получателя с адресами, хранящимися в таблице, и находит нужное устройство.

Кроме того, важно отметить, что PCI контроллер может использовать разные методы маршрутизации данных в зависимости от настроек и требований. Он может использовать прямую маршрутизацию, когда данные передаются напрямую от источника к получателю, или использовать переключение маршрута, когда данные передаются через промежуточные узлы на основе таблицы маршрутизации.

Маршрутизация данных в PCI контроллере играет важную роль в обеспечении эффективной передачи информации между устройствами. Она позволяет эффективно управлять трафиком данных и гарантировать доставку сообщений и команд в нужное устройство.

Таким образом, маршрутизация данных в PCI контроллере основана на анализе заголовка сообщения и использовании таблицы устройств для определения пути передачи данных. Это позволяет контроллеру эффективно передавать данные между устройствами и обеспечивать их надежность и целостность.

Если вы считаете, что данный ответ неверен или обнаружили фактическую ошибку, пожалуйста, оставьте комментарий! Мы обязательно исправим проблему.
Андрей

Журналист. Автор статей о связях литературы с другими видами искусств.

Оцените автора
Армения
Добавить комментарий